Intended Use
Delivery of restorative and impression material.
Device Story
Manual delivery device for restorative and impression materials; stainless steel barrel, polypropylene plunger, rubber plunger tip; operated by dental professionals; facilitates precise application of dental materials into oral cavity; replaces glass syringe counterparts; provides durable, reusable delivery mechanism.
Clinical Evidence
Bench testing only.
Technological Characteristics
Materials: stainless steel barrel, polypropylene plunger, rubber plunger tip. Manual operation; reusable; non-powered.
Indications for Use
Indicated for the delivery of restorative and impression materials in clinical dental settings.
Regulatory Classification
Identification
Bone grafting material is a material such as hydroxyapatite, tricalcium phosphate, polylactic and polyglycolic acids, or collagen, that is intended to fill, augment, or reconstruct periodontal or bony defects of the oral and maxillofacial region.
Special Controls
*Classification.* (1) Class II (special controls) for bone grafting materials that do not contain a drug that is a therapeutic biologic. The special control is FDA's “Class II Special Controls Guidance Document: Dental Bone Grafting Material Devices.” (See § 872.1(e) for the availability of this guidance document.)(2) Class III (premarket approval) for bone grafting materials that contain a drug that is a therapeutic biologic. Bone grafting materials that contain a drug that is a therapeutic biologic, such as biological response modifiers, require premarket approval. (c) *Date premarket approval application (PMA) or notice of product development protocol (PDP) is required.* Devices described in paragraph (b)(2) of this section shall have an approved PMA or a declared completed PDP in effect before being placed in commercial distribution.
